1. Which flickering lights\ solution are better?

The effectiveness of flickering lights\ solutions depends on the specific cause of the flickering and the context in\ which it occurs. Some solutions may be more suitable for certain situations or\ types of lighting systems than others. Here are several flickering lights\ solutions that are commonly considered effective:

Tightening\ Connections : Ensuring that all electrical connections, including bulbs,\ fixtures, switches, and outlets, are securely tightened can often resolve\ flickering caused by loose connections.

Replacing\ Faulty Bulbs : Swapping out old, damaged, or incompatible light bulbs with new\ ones designed for the specific fixture and application can eliminate flickering\ caused by bulb issues.

Upgrading\ Dimmer Switches : Installing dimmer switches that are compatible with the type\ of bulbs being used, such as LED-compatible dimmers, can address flickering\ associated with dimming systems.

Addressing\ Voltage Fluctuations : Installing voltage stabilizers, surge protectors, or\ power conditioners can mitigate flickering caused by fluctuations in the\ electrical supply.

Inspecting\ and Repairing Wiring : Checking for damaged or degraded wiring and repairing or\ replacing it as needed can resolve flickering caused by wiring issues.

6. Upgrading\ Electrical Panels : Upgrading consumer units to accommodate increased loads\ or to improve electrical distribution can address flickering related to\ inadequate electrical capacity.

7. Professional\ Diagnosis and Repair : Engaging qualified electricians in Lipson (PL12) or technicians to conduct\ a thorough diagnosis and implement appropriate repairs is often the most\ effective solution for complex or persistent flickering issues.

8. Environmental\ Considerations : Addressing external factors such as electromagnetic\ interference or environmental conditions that may affect lighting system\ performance can help eliminate flickering.

9. Regular\ Maintenance : Implementing a schedule for routine maintenance, including\ cleaning fixtures, inspecting connections, and replacing worn-out components,\ can prevent flickering from recurring.

The best flickering lights solution depends\ on the specific circumstances and causes of the flickering. It's essential to\ accurately diagnose the problem and choose the most appropriate solution based\ on factors such as the type of lighting system, the condition of components,\ and environmental factors. In some cases, a combination of solutions may be\ necessary to effectively resolve the issue.

3. Are flickering lights\ solution fix garden lights?

Yes, flickering lights solutions can be\ applied to fix garden lights as well. Garden lights, like any other lighting\ system, can experience flickering due to various factors, including issues with\ electrical components, wiring, or environmental factors. Common\ flickering lights solutions that can be applied to garden lights:

Tightening\ Connections : Ensure that all electrical connections in the garden light\ fixtures, including bulbs, sockets, and wiring connections, are securely\ tightened. Loose connections can cause flickering.

Replacing\ Faulty Bulbs : If garden light bulbs are old, damaged, or incompatible with\ the fixtures, replacing them with new, compatible bulbs can eliminate\ flickering issues.

3. Inspecting Wiring : Check the wiring\ connections in the garden light fixtures for any damage, wear, or corrosion.\ Repair or replace damaged wiring as needed to ensure a stable electrical\ connection.

4. Upgrading Dimmer Controls : If garden lights\ are equipped with dimmer controls, ensure that the dimmer switches are\ compatible with the type of bulbs being used. Upgrading to dimmer switches\ designed for LED or low-voltage lighting can help prevent flickering.

5. Environmental Considerations : Outdoor\ lighting systems, including garden lights, may be susceptible to environmental\ factors such as moisture, temperature fluctuations, or soil movement.\ Protecting garden light fixtures from exposure to water or extreme weather\ conditions can help prevent flickering.

6. Using\ Quality Components : Use high-quality, outdoor-rated light fixtures, bulbs,\ and wiring designed for outdoor use. Ensure that all components are suitable\ for the outdoor environment and can withstand exposure to the elements.

7. Professional\ Inspection and Repair : If flickering issues persist despite DIY\ troubleshooting, it may be necessary to consult with a professional electrician in Lipson (PL12)\ or outdoor lighting specialist. These professionals can conduct a thorough\ inspection of the garden lighting system and recommend appropriate repairs or\ upgrades.

By applying these flickering lights\ solutions to garden lights, it's possible to resolve flickering issues and\ ensure reliable and consistent illumination in outdoor spaces. Proper\ maintenance and occasional checks can help prevent flickering problems from\ recurring and extend the lifespan of garden lighting systems.
